Output cd3b4e6a734396d90fb7f34fe902aa9604279c85a27f05c8d93943541c30e8b5:4

value
29481719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ec0c21a86d8c96e6eaad0a8e3b95b60e918aba2 OP_EQUAL
address
MCANEL6muNzyj5Yj76UrMi7NifNq1MsfZV
transaction
cd3b4e6a734396d90fb7f34fe902aa9604279c85a27f05c8d93943541c30e8b5
spent
true